Hidden Killers in Your Kitchen: Foods That Are Fatal to Your Dog

  7 Forbidden Foods That Can Be Fatal to Your Dog (Avoid These!)


As pet owners, we often love to share our food with our furry friends. However, our digestive systems are very different from theirs. Some foods that are perfectly safe for humans can be toxic or even fatal to dogs.😨😱


Here are 7 common foods you should strictly keep away from your dog😨☠️:


1. Chocolate πŸš«


Chocolate contains 'theobromine,' which is highly toxic to dogs. It can cause an increased heart rate, seizures, and in severe cases, it can be fatal. Dark chocolate and baking chocolate are the most dangerous.

Impact on Heart Health: Foods like chocolate contain chemicals that disrupt a dog's normal heart rhythm, potentially leading to long-term heart complications or sudden heart failure.


Dental Decay: Just like humans, dogs are prone to dental issues. Regularly feeding them sugary treats can lead to severe tooth decay, gum disease, and painful tooth infections, which can eventually make it difficult for them to eat.

2. Onions and Garlic πŸš«


When it comes to onions and garlic, never even consider adding them to your dog's food.

Whether raw, cooked, or powdered, onions and garlic can damage a dog's red blood cells, leading to anemia. Even small amounts can cause weakness and breathing difficulties.


3. Grapes and Raisins πŸš«


Even a small quantity of grapes or raisins can cause sudden kidney failure in dogs. Symptoms usually include repeated vomiting and extreme lethargy.


4. Dairy Products (Milk and Cheese) πŸš«


Many dogs are lactose intolerant. Consuming milk or cheese can lead to digestive issues, including diarrhea, gas, and severe abdominal discomfort.


Puppies have extremely sensitive digestive systems. Never feed them regular cow's milk or human food. The best and most natural nutrition for a puppy is their mother's milk. If the mother is not available or cannot nurse, only use a veterinarian-recommended 'Puppy Milk Replacer' specifically formulated for dogs. Feeding them regular milk can lead to severe diarrhea and serious digestive issues that can be life-threatening to a young puppy.


5. Caffeine (Coffee and Tea)🚫


Caffeine is a stimulant that is very dangerous for dogs. It affects their heart and nervous system, potentially causing tremors, seizures, and heart failure.

"Coffee might brighten your day, but it could be the end of your puppy's life."


6. Macadamia Nuts πŸš«


These nuts are specifically toxic to dogs. Consuming them can lead to weakness in the legs, tremors, vomiting, and hyperthermia (overheating).


7. Excessive Salt πŸš«


Human snacks like chips, crackers, or processed foods high in salt can lead to sodium ion poisoning in dogs. Symptoms include excessive thirst, urination, and sometimes tremors or seizures.


What to do if your dog eats a forbidden food?

1;Stay Calm: Observe your dog's behavior closely.🧐🧐🧐


2;Contact Your Vet Immediately: If your dog shows any signs of illness (vomiting, lethargy, or twitching), seek professional veterinary help immediately.πŸ©ΊπŸ§‘‍⚕️


3;Be Prepared: Try to identify exactly what your dog ate and how much. Providing this information to the vet will help them provide the right treatment quickly.🀷‍♂️

Top 5 Healthy Foods for Your Dog

 

Puppy eating healthy homemade food

Top 5 Healthy Foods for Your Dog

1. Introduction

Keeping your furry friend healthy starts with what’s in their bowl. Just like humans, dogs need a balanced diet to stay active and happy. Providing nutritious, homemade-friendly foods can significantly improve their quality of life.


2. The Top 5 FoodsπŸ‘‡


πŸ‘‰ Chicken/(Small pieces/Choking hazard)  (Cooked & Plain): Chicken is an excellent source of lean protein. Always make sure to boil it without any salt, spices, or onions, as these are harmful to dogs.

[When feeding chicken to your puppies, always remember to cut it into very small, bite-sized pieces. Puppies have small jaws and are still learning to chew, so large chunks can be difficult for them to swallow and may even pose a choking hazard. Serving it finely chopped ensures they can eat comfortably and digest it better.]


πŸ‘‰ Carrots: These are fantastic for a dog's dental health. Carrots are rich in Vitamin A and provide a crunchy, low-calorie treat that most dogs absolutely love.

Many dogs are not fond of eating raw carrots. To make it more appetizing, try cutting the carrots into small pieces and steaming or boiling them slightly until they are soft. Mixing these cooked carrots with plain, boiled chicken makes a tasty and nutritious meal that your dog will surely love.


πŸ‘‰ White Rice: If your dog has an upset stomach, plain boiled rice is very easy to digest. It’s a gentle way to provide energy without putting pressure on their digestive system.

When serving rice, ensure it is thoroughly boiled and soft (mushy). Puppies generally find soft, well-cooked rice much easier to eat and more palatable. Avoid serving hard or undercooked grains, as they can be difficult for a puppy to digest properly.


πŸ‘‰ Plain Yogurt: A small amount of plain, unsweetened yogurt contains probiotics that help maintain a healthy gut. Just be sure it contains no xylitol or artificial sweeteners.

While plain yogurt can be beneficial, please avoid giving your dog regular dairy milk or milk powder. Most dogs are lactose intolerant, and milk powder can lead to severe stomach upsets, diarrhea, and digestive discomfort. Stick to probiotic-rich plain yogurt in small amounts instead.


πŸ‘‰ Eggs: Eggs are a nutritional powerhouse. They are packed with essential amino acids and fatty acids that help keep your dog’s coat shiny and their muscles strong. Always serve them fully cooked.

Eggs are a fantastic source of protein, but always ensure they are hard-boiled before serving to avoid any risk of bacteria. For picky eaters, try mashing a hard-boiled egg and mixing it thoroughly with their portion of boiled rice. This makes the meal much more flavorful and encourages them to finish their food happily.


3. Conclusion & Safety Tips😎

While these foods are healthy, always introduce new items in small quantities to see how your dog reacts. Before making major changes to your pet’s diet, it’s always best to consult with your veterinarian. Finally, ensure your dog always has access to fresh, clean water throughout the day.Finally, pay attention to the water bowl you use. It is best to provide water in a shallow, sturdy, and wide bowl rather than a tall cup. This makes it easier and more comfortable for your dog to drink without putting strain on their neck or whiskers. Always keep the bowl clean and filled with fresh water throughout the day.

5 Simple Ways to Keep Your Pet Happy and HealthyπŸ‘‡πŸ‘‡πŸ‘‡

Happy and healthy pets

 As pet owners, our furry friends are part of the family. We all want them to live long, happy lives. Here are 5 simple, effective tips to ensure your pet stays in top shape:

1. Provide a Balanced Diet Just like humans, pets need high-quality nutrition. Always choose food that is appropriate for their age, size, and breed. Avoid giving them too many table scraps, as these can lead to obesity.

2. Keep Them Hydrated Fresh, clean water is essential. Ensure your pet has access to a water bowl at all times. Change the water daily to prevent bacteria build-up.

3. Regular Exercise Physical activity keeps your pet’s heart healthy and their muscles strong. Whether it's a daily walk for your dog or playtime with a feather toy for your cat, make sure they get enough movement.

4. Routine Vet Check-ups Preventive care is better than a cure. Schedule regular vet visits for vaccinations and health screenings, even if your pet seems perfectly fine.

5. Love and Mental Stimulation Pets crave attention. Spend quality time with them every day—petting, training, or simply playing. Mental stimulation, such as puzzle toys, can also keep their minds sharp.

If you notice any sudden changes in your pet’s behavior or appetite, do not hesitate to consult your veterinarian immediately.
